Login  Regeln Aktuelles Datum und Uhrzeit: 05.12.2008, 01:50  
Startseite
Registrieren
Profil
Suchen
Mitgliederliste
Verzeichnis
Impressum



Partner
kostenlose Homepage
Fussball
Kostenloses Forum
SMS kostenlos
Webhosting
Webmasterportal
Kostenlos
Kredit ohne Schufa
Esoterik-Forum
Selbsthilfeforum
Artikel Backlink
Datenrettung
JavaScript: Auf Option ChildNode zugreifen

 
Neues Thema eröffnen   Neue Antwort erstellen    Webmaster Forum -> HTML & CSS
Vorheriges Thema anzeigen Nächstes Thema anzeigen 
Autor Nachricht
JFM
Beliebter [User]
Beliebter



Anmeldung: 25.09.05
Beiträge: 425
Wohnort: Gütersloh

BeitragVerfasst am: 25.03.2008, 09:25    Titel: JavaScript: Auf Option ChildNode zugreifen Antworten mit Zitat

Hallo,
folgendes Problem für das ich keine Lösung finde:

Ich habe eine Selectbox, etwa so:

Code:

<select id="select_1" name="player_a">
<option value="1">Brinkmann</option>
<option value="34">Müller</option>
<option value="55">Meier</option>
</select>


Ich weiß das ich den Value-Wert des Ausgewählten Elements mit
Code:
document.getElementById("select_1").value;

erhalten kann.
So würde ich also entweder 1,34 oder 55 erhalten, je nachdem was gerade ausgewählt ist.

Wie komme ich aber an den Namen, also an Brinkmann, Müller oder Meier?
Da komme ich irgendwie nicht so recht ans Ziel.
Ich habe das irgendwie mit childNode versucht, erhalte aber immer nur irgendwelche Ausgaben die ich nicht wirklich will und auch nicht so recht deuten kann ^^

Vielleicht habt ihr ja eine Idee?!

Grüße Jörg[/code]

_________________
http://www.onestripe.de


Nach oben
Private Nachricht senden Website dieses Benutzers besuchen
Professor
Stammuser [User]
Stammuser



Anmeldung: 02.11.07
Beiträge: 34

BeitragVerfasst am: 25.03.2008, 19:56    Titel: Antworten mit Zitat

hallo

der leichteste weg auf einzelne elemente eines select zuzugreifen
wäre nicht über eine id im select selbst, sondern über die option
des elements

also z.b. so
Code:

document.getElementsByTagName("option")[0].firstChild.data;


so würde man direkt auf den namen Brinkmann zugreifen
und mit dem zähler [0] dann natürlich auch auf die anderen einträge

also z.b. so
Code:

document.getElementsByTagName("option")[1].firstChild.data;


so würde man direkt auf den namen Müller zugreifen

wenn man statt des firstChild.data das value oder selected nimmt,
kann man natürlich auch auf die inneren werte zugreifen

prof.


Nach oben
Private Nachricht senden
Beiträge der letzten Zeit anzeigen:   
Neues Thema eröffnen   Neue Antwort erstellen Alle Zeiten sind GMT + 1 Stunde
Seite 1 von 1

Gehe zu:  

Ähnliche Beiträge
Thema Autor Forum Antworten Verfasst am
Keine neuen Beiträge Zugreifen auf einzelne Datensätze aus... xxcool25xx Serverseitige Websprachen 8 28.11.2008, 10:08 Letzten Beitrag anzeigen
Keine neuen Beiträge Mausverfolgerproblem Flash / Javascript jonatan_männchen HTML & CSS 1 19.11.2008, 19:47 Letzten Beitrag anzeigen
Keine neuen Beiträge Javascript Hilfe Erdenbuerger Einsteigerforum 7 18.11.2008, 17:01 Letzten Beitrag anzeigen
Keine neuen Beiträge Onclick Javascript Problem im IE Timbo23 HTML & CSS 3 26.10.2008, 23:33 Letzten Beitrag anzeigen
Keine neuen Beiträge Auf Homepage zugreifen Benja91 Einsteigerforum 1 19.09.2008, 16:26 Letzten Beitrag anzeigen
Threadübersicht